Habitat For Humanity has experienced a notable rise in global media coverage, with 15 mentions within a recent reporting window—15 times higher than usual. This surge indicates increased international attention on its housing projects and advocacy efforts.

According to the GDELT Project, a media monitoring organization, Habitat For Humanity was mentioned 15 times in a recent reporting window, compared to its typical baseline of one mention. This indicates a substantial increase in media interest, likely driven by recent campaigns, global events, or new initiatives by the organization.
While the exact causes of this surge are not fully detailed, experts suggest that recent high-profile projects, partnerships, or advocacy campaigns may be contributing factors. International awareness of its work continues to grow, reflecting the trend.
